Signs of Roof Leaks and How to Repair Them
A leaking roofing system can turn your home into a frustration otherwise resolved promptly. You might not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, which frequently suggest a leakage. If you see peeling off paint or mold and mildew development, it's a sign that wetness is trapped. Furthermore, pay attention for dripping noises throughout rain; that's a clear red flag.
To fix these issues, start by locating the resource of the leakage. Inspect your attic for signs of moisture or water access. You can secure tiny spaces with roofing concrete or caulk once you identify the trouble area. For even more considerable damage, you might require to change tiles or perhaps repair flashing. Constantly assure safety and security first-- use a tough ladder and take into consideration employing a professional if you're unclear. Dealing with leaks without delay can aid you stay clear of costly repair services down the line and keep your home risk-free and completely dry.

Visual Examination Techniques
To properly determine missing or harmed shingles, begin by conducting a detailed visual assessment of your roofing. Grab a set of field glasses for a more detailed look, or utilize a ladder if you fit. Look for any type of shingles that are curled, split, or entirely missing. Pay special attention to areas around smokeshafts, vents, and valleys, as these places are vulnerable to damages. Look for granules in your gutters or on the ground, which indicates wear. If you observe any kind of staining or irregular surface areas, that could signal a problem. Don't neglect to inspect the edges of your roof; broken or loosened roof shingles here can cause bigger problems. Normal assessments can help keep your roofing's integrity.

Avoidance and Therapy Approaches
Overlooking moss and algae can bring about substantial problems, however taking safety nets and dealing with any kind of existing growth can protect your roofing system. Begin by routinely cleaning your roofing system to eliminate debris and wetness, as this produces an atmosphere for growth. If you observe moss or algae, utilize a mixture of water and bleach to delicately scrub the influenced locations. For avoidance, take into consideration setting up zinc or copper strips along the ridge of your roofing system; these metals hinder development as rain washes over them. Furthermore, ensure your roofing system has proper air flow to reduce dampness buildup. By remaining proactive and resolving these problems without delay, you can prolong your roofing system's life-span and preserve its stability, conserving you costly fixings down the line.
Comprehending Roofing Air Flow Issues
Proper roofing air flow is important for preserving the stability of your home, as it assists manage temperature and wetness degrees in the attic room. Without appropriate ventilation, you could encounter significant issues like mold development, timber rot, and enhanced energy costs. Examine your roofing system for indicators of inadequate air flow, such as too much warmth in the attic during hot months or condensation basing on rafters.
You should likewise try to find unequal snow melting in winter, suggesting trapped warm. If you discover any of these indicators, it's time to review your ventilation system. Make certain you have a balanced intake and exhaust system, permitting fresh air in and stale air out.
You might require to include ridge vents, soffit vents, or gable vents to enhance air flow. Routine upkeep and tracking can prevent expensive fixings down the line, so do not ignore this critical facet of your roof.

Exactly How to Area Roof Covering Flashing Problems
Maintaining great air flow is simply one component of a well-functioning roofing system; roofing blinking plays a vital function in maintaining your home secure from water damages. To detect blinking problems, begin by evaluating the locations where different roof areas fulfill, like smokeshafts, valleys, and vents. Seek any type of noticeable spaces, rust, or peeling off paint, which can show damage. Look for cracks in the caulk or sealer that may enable water to seep with.
Also, check out the flashing for any kind of signs of flexing or misalignment; these problems can jeopardize its performance. After heavy rains, expect water stains on your walls or ceilings, as this may signify flashing failure. It's essential to address them quickly to stop pricey damage if you see any of these signs. Frequently evaluate your flashing to ensure it remains in excellent problem and doing its critical function.
